MarketAxess Average Daily Volume Rises in November vs Year Ago
Dec 4, 2024 6:12 AM

08:37 AM EST, 12/04/2024 (MT Newswires) -- MarketAxess Holdings ( MKTX ) said Wednesday its total average daily volume came in at $44.95 billion in November, up 56% from a year earlier but down 3% compared to October.

Total rates ADV was $30.7 billion in November, up 112% from a year ago, but down 2% compared to October, the company said.

High-grade credit ADV was $6.53 billion in November, compared with $6.52 billion a year earlier, while high-yield credit ADV was $1.31 billion last month, compared to $1.91 billion a year ago, the company said.

MarketAxess ( MKTX ) shares fell more than 3% in recent premarket activity.
